TD Coliseum
TD Coliseum is a sports and entertainment arena at the corner of Bay Street North and York Boulevard in Hamilton, Ontario, Canada. Opened in 1985 as Copps Coliseum, it has a capacity of up to 18,000.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Art Gallery of Hamilton
Art gallery
Photo: MeganAGH,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Art Gallery of Hamilton is an art museum located in Hamilton, Ontario, Canada. The museum occupies a 7,000 square metres building on King Street West in downtown Hamilton, designed by Trevor P. Art Gallery of Hamilton is situated 220 metres south of TD Coliseum.
Hamilton City Hall
Town hall
Photo: Flar, Public domain.
Hamilton City Hall is the chief administrative building for the city of Hamilton. Located in the downtown core, it is an 8-storey building at the corner of Main Street West and Bay Street South, across the street from the FirstOntario Concert Hall and the Art Gallery of Hamilton. Hamilton City Hall is situated 410 metres south of TD Coliseum.

Hess Village
Neighborhood
Hess Village is a pedestrianized area in the downtown of Hamilton, Ontario, Canada. Its streets, in contrast to other areas in Hamilton, are quite thin and restrict vehicle access.
Beasley
Neighborhood
Beasley is a neighbourhood in the Lower City area of Hamilton, Ontario, Canada. The Beasley neighbourhood is bounded in the north by the Canadian National Railway tracks just north of Barton Street, James Street, Main Street and Wellington Street.
